Coyote Cinema: Tron Legacy

The Dude Abides. In Cyberspace.

He's also occasionally Ben Kenobi.

Much like my friend Kirby put it, this would be a fitting sequel if nothing had happened in the field of computing for thirty years. It's kind of like those fifties stories about the future, or "steampunk". And as a retro-futuristic religious allegory, it works pretty well. If you can navigate around the plot holes, which I did okay on.

Also, apparently programs now like to party, drink, flirt, and presumably screw. They've changed a lot since we were setting high scores on Space Paranoids.

The movie made me laugh, even if it might not have all been intended. And honestly? Watching David Bowie host Andy Warhol's party with a soundtrack by Kraftwerk in and of itself made the movie worth watching.
